Many people refer to Steps 10–12 as the “maintenance steps,” often pointing to the phrase “maintenance of our spiritual condition” (BB p.85). But a closer look at AA literature shows something very different: these are not maintenance steps at all—they are growth steps. 🎧 Wherever you listen to podcasts 🕕 New episodes Sundays @ 6PM CST 🌐 www.relevant-recovery.org 🔗 linktr.ee/relevantrecovery #ForGoodAndForAll #RelevantRecovery #12Steps #WeDoRecover #SoberPodcast #Godtho

We often treat the sex inventory as if it’s only about sexual behavior, yet the Big Book and 12&12 show it is much deeper. It is really an examination of how we show up in relationships — whether we are selfish, dishonest, or inconsiderate. Today we look at what the sex inventory actually reveals about us and what it looks like to show up in sane, healthy relationships. 🎧 Wherever you listen to podcasts 🕕 New episodes Sundays @ 6PM CST 🌐 www.relevant-recovery.org 🔗 linktr.ee/relevantrecovery #ForGoodAndForAll #RelevantRecovery #12Steps #WeDoRecover #SoberPodcast #Godtho

In this episode, we break down the true purpose of fellowship in AA—what it is, what it is not, and why it’s essential. Fellowship doesn’t keep us sober and it isn’t the program itself—but it is the vehicle that connects us to the people, relationships, and opportunities that make working the program possible. 🎧 Wherever you listen to podcasts 🕕 New episodes Sundays @ 6PM CST 🌐 www.relevant-recovery.org 🔗 linktr.ee/relevantrecovery #ForGoodAndForAll #RelevantRecovery #12Steps #WeDoRecover #SoberPodcast #Godtho
